C2oooProg是为TI C2000™系列微控制器设计的闪存编程工具,它不使用JTAG作为编程工具与微控制器之间的通信接口,而是采用了RS-232、RS-485和CAN(控制器区域网络)通讯协议。这种设计使C2oooProg非常适合在JTAG端口通常不可访问的现场环境中部署。 C2oooProg的主要特点包括: 1. 快速通信协议,该协议能够可靠地与USB转RS232转换器一起工作,适用于多种环境。 2. 支持点对点以及多点网络通讯,方便在不同设备间进行编程操作。 3. 能够智能检测哪些Flash扇区需要被擦除(或者如果需要的话,手动选择擦除扇区)。 4. 自动产生32位循环冗余校验(CRC),并进行编程操作,允许固件在微控制器启动时验证闪存的完整性。 5. 兼容标准的Intel Hex文件,允许将其他数据(如FPGA代码)编程到DSC Flash中。 6. 扩展的Hex文件可以被加密,并且包含编程所需的所有设置,包括二级引导加载器。 7. 远程链接文件允许从服务器上存储的扩展Hex文件进行编程。 8. 命令行接口,可以被其他程序调用,用于批量编程。 9. DTR/RTS控制,用于在引导加载模式下重置微控制器。 使用C2oooProg进行快速开始的步骤包括: 1. 下载最新版本的编程器程序可以从CodeSkin网站下载。 2. 使用Windows安装程序“setup.exe”进行安装,也可以像其他Windows软件一样通过控制面板进行卸载。 3. C2oooProg需要安装Java运行环境(JRE版本1.5或更高)才能运行,可以从Sun Microsystems网站免费下载。 为了生成Hex文件,C2oooProg支持从COFF文件直接生成16位地址和数据宽度的Intel-Hex文件。以下是使用命令行生成Hex文件的示例命令: ``` c2400-tools: c2000-tools: dsphex -romwidth 16 -memwidth 16 -i -o .\Debug\code.hex .\Debug\code.out 2000-romwidth 16 -memwidth 16 -i -o .\Debug\test.hex .\Debug\test.out ``` 对于使用Code Composer Studio的用户,也可以进行相应的操作来生成所需的Hex文件。 在进行编程操作之前,C2oooProg还提供了详细的命令行选项和参数的解释,确保用户可以准确无误地执行各种编程任务。而自动产生的32位CRC校验值则能够确保在微控制器启动时验证闪存的完整性,保障系统稳定运行。 此外,C2oooProg所支持的扩展Hex文件不仅可以被加密,还能够包含编程所需的全部设置,包括二级引导加载器,这对于更复杂的编程需求提供了很大的便利。远程链接文件的功能则进一步扩展了编程的可能性,能够从远程服务器上下载并编程扩展的Hex文件。 C2oooProg的命令行接口功能,使得它能够被其他程序调用,这对于批量编程和自动化操作非常有用。DTR/RTS控制提供了额外的灵活性,在引导加载模式下重置微控制器。 为了正确使用C2oooProg,用户需要遵循版权说明,并遵守CodeSkin LLC公司保留的所有权利。在使用过程中,确保对软件的正确安装和配置,以及遵循正确的编程流程,这些都是确保软件能够顺利运行和达到预期效果的前提条件。


剩余10页未读,继续阅读











- 粉丝: 8
我的内容管理 展开
我的资源 快来上传第一个资源
我的收益
登录查看自己的收益我的积分 登录查看自己的积分
我的C币 登录后查看C币余额
我的收藏
我的下载
下载帮助


最新资源
- 安全性问题用基因工程方法生产的产品.pptx
- 西门子水处理1200PLC程序模板及触摸屏组态:工业自动化学习与应用的全面指南
- 现阶段配电网自动化建设.ppt
- 单片机教学计划.pdf
- 算法分析与设计考试复习题及参考答案.doc
- 土木工程知识点-项目管理经验谈——看完你就能做项目经理.doc
- 半桥LLC谐振变换器滞环控制与变频控制对比:启动平滑、响应迅速,输出电压波形及S1管子ZVS情况仿真分析(基于Matlab Simulink环境)
- 双馈风机并网储能系统的一次调频仿真及参数优化 - MATLABSimulink实现
- 三相维也纳Vienna架构SVPWM整流器:Matlab仿真模型文件详解——高PF值、低THD、精准电压转换与电流控制策略
- 农业物联网领域基于组态王6.53仿真的大棚温湿控制系统设计与PLC应用
- MCGS嵌入版7.6加热炉模拟仿真:运行效果与代码解析 精选版
- 基于Multisim的交通灯电路仿真设计:状态转换与数码管显示功能详解 详解
- MATLAB环境下数据批量处理、图像处理及风速时程模拟的GUIApp Designer界面设计 · 图像处理
- Comsol仿真技术解析:有损金属材料的高品质因子分析及其应用
- 单电阻FOC版本STM32与MD500E永磁同步PMSM无感算法方案及高性价比变频器解决方案
- LSDYNA材料本构经验笔记:涵盖多种材料模型的详细解析及其应用



评论0